This week on Babel, Jon Alterman speaks with eL Seed, an award-winning French-Tunisian artist whose monumental artwork blending the styles of Arabic calligraphy and graffiti is spreading in the Arab world and far beyond. His smaller works are in some of the most important museum collections around the world, but he takes special pride in his process of working with communities to select meaningful quotations to inspire his art and then to execute that artwork together. Jon and eL Seed discuss the cultural and political forces that shaped eL Seed's artistic evolution, as well as art’s role in spurring social change. Then, Jon continues the conversation with Martin Pimentel and Natasha Hall to discuss the ways art anchors Middle Eastern diaspora communities to their homelands and interacts with political movements across the Arab world.
